Murugan wants Jeeva Samadhi

Chennai, July 23: Sriharan alias Murugan, a life convict in Rajiv Gandhi assassination case, has petitioned the prison department to allow him to observe 'Jeeva Samadhi' to end his misery.

According to a senior official information in the Vellore Central Prison for Men where Murugan has been lodged for over two decades, the life convict submitted his petition to the superintendent of prison G Shanmughasundaram on July 19.

The petition was addressed to the additional director general of police (ADGP) of prisons Sylendra Babu.

Murugan appealed to the ADGP to allow him to fulfill his wish to attain 'Jeeva samadhi' as he wanted to end his agony of undergoing imprisonment for over 26 years.

In his petition, Murugan stated that he would stop taking food from August 18.

"We forwarded the petition to the ADGP," a senior prison official told to media.

On other hand, The Rajiv Gandhi assassination case convict Nalini has decided to move Madras High Court on Monday to seek six months parole for her daughter's wedding.
